We are gathering around for another MLS Matchday. After an action-packed week capped by an MLS All-Star Game victory, our attention now turns to the weekend and the thrilling matchup ahead.
For the last game of the night, we have the Cascadia Cup. This means that the Portland Timbers vs the Seattle Sounders will face each other.
The good news for the Timbers is that the last time they met was a few weeks ago. The final score of the game was 5-1 in favour of the Timbers, in what was a soccer masterclass.

Injury Report
Portland Timbers:
- OUT: Alexander Aravena (hip)
- OUT: Gage Guerra (core)
- OUT: Juan Mosquera (foot/ankle)
Seattle Sounders:
- OUT: Pedro de la Vega (knee)
- OUT: Yeimar Gómez Andrade (calf)
- OUT: Jordan Morris (quad)
- OUT: Nikola Petkovic (knee)
- OUT: Cristian Roldan (quad)
- Questionable: Hassani Dotson (hamstring)
- Questionable: Kim Kee-hee (hamstring)
- Questionable: Alex Roldan (hip)
- Questionable: Ryan Sailor (knee)
Score Prediction
This derby is a must-watch. Last time it finished 5-1 in favour of the Timbers. And once again, circumstances seem to favor the home side.
The Seattle Sounders have now lost five straight matches, one of the worst stretches of their MLS campaign.
Yet, despite this challenging run, they still hold a better position in the standings than the Timbers. However, stats don’t lie, and the Timbers should have the upper hand in this encounter.
